X5310 TO H.{Arthur M. Hanbury - Head Complaints}, FROM A.J.B. SECRET. AJB2/125.3.25. Copy to - R.{Sir Henry Royce} HS.{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air} INDIA. 4 SPEED GEARBOX. We received the following telegram from you this morning:- "TELEGRAM RECEIVED FROM ROYCE AS FOLLOWS:- "REALISED FROM FIRST CREEPING DUE TO INSUFFICIENT "BIND ON SHAFT. NOW UNDERSTAND SECOND AND REVERSE "SATISFACTORY TROUBLE ONLY WITH FIRST AND YOU REFER "TO PINIONS OF INCREASED DIAMETER. CONSIDER SPIRAL "KEYS UNDESIRABLE SUGGEST INCREASING ANGLE OF ACME "SPLINES OR TESTING SQUARE OR EVEN HEXAGON SHAFT." We have therefore prepared a drawing, LeC. 2038., the original accompanying this memo., and a print accompanying R's copy. This drawing shows the stiffer 2nd motion shaft recently asked for by R.{Sir Henry Royce} and also the 3 sections of the rear end of this shaft suggested in the above telegram. These should be constructed in conjunction with the 1st. and 2nd. speed pinions with increased number of teeth. AJS. | ||
